Getting Started Unpacking: When removing the systems from their packaging, it is important not to grasp the units from the front. Because the high frequency device is located near the top of the cabinet on the front baffle, a stray hand or finger can cause damage. The best way to safely unpack your monitors is to open the top of the box, keep the cardboard filler piece on, and roll the box upside down. The box can then be slipped off. LSR6328P Biamplified Studio Monitor System Boundary Compensation Switch 5 introduces a low frequency shelf roll-off of -1.5 dB, while Switch 6 introduces a low frequency shelf rolloff of -3 dB. Engaging both switches will produce a low frequency shelf rolloff of -4.5 dB. These functions are known as Boundary Compensation and are used to adjust for the build-up of low frequencies that accompany the placement of loudspeakers near walls or corners, or work surfaces. LSR6332 Studio Monitor System This adjustment is accomplished via the barrier strip on the back of the enclosure located above the dual pair of 5-way binding posts. Moving the link between the 0 and -1 dB positions will change the high frequency drive level. Please note that the loudspeaker should be disconnected from the amplifier during this procedure for safety of the system. LSR6312SP Powered Subwoofer System There are several ways to connect the LSR6312SP in a monitoring system including stereo, multi-channel for- mats such as Dolby ProLogic, AC-3, DTS, and others. The bass management system in the LSR6312SP pro- vides the flexibility to switch between configurations. In a Stereo Configuration, it is typical to feed the LSR6312SP with the left and right channels and take the left and right outputs from the LSR6312SP and feed them to the satellites.
